Python EV3开发库的下载与安装指南
版权申诉
139 浏览量
更新于2024-11-11
收藏 1.4MB ZIP 举报
资源摘要信息:"Python库 | python_ev3dev-0.2.1.post11-py2.7-linux-armv5tejl.egg"
知识点详细说明:
1. Python库的含义及其作用:
Python库是指一系列预先编写好的Python模块、函数、类等的集合,它们按照特定结构组织在一起,以便于开发者能够重用这些代码,实现特定功能。使用Python库可以大大提高开发效率,避免重复造轮子,同时使得代码更加简洁、易于维护。在本次资源文件中提到的"python_ev3dev-0.2.1.post11-py2.7-linux-armv5tejl.egg"是一个专用于Python 2.7版本的库文件。
2. Python库的分类与用途:
Python库通常分为标准库和第三方库。标准库是Python自带的库,涵盖了从字符串操作到网络编程等多个领域的工具。第三方库则是由社区成员开发,通过Python包索引PyPI进行分发。在本例中的python_ev3dev库属于第三方库,其主要用途可能与EV3DEV开发相关,EV3DEV是一个开源项目,旨在让树莓派兼容乐高Mindstorms EV3机器人。
3. 描述中提到的资源分类:
资源分类是指对库文件进行的分类,帮助开发者快速识别库文件的功能和用途。本例中资源分类为"Python库",意味着这是为Python语言提供的扩展功能集合。
4. 所属语言:
所属语言指的是该资源文件适用的编程语言,这里明确指出为Python语言。使用Python语言编写的库文件,能够被Python程序调用以执行特定任务。
5. 使用前提:
使用前提强调了在使用库文件之前必须满足的条件。本资源文件需要解压,这意味着在安装或使用之前,需要先对压缩包进行解压缩操作,以获取库文件的原始内容。
6. 资源全名及其组成:
资源全名"python_ev3dev-0.2.1.post11-py2.7-linux-armv5tejl.egg"表明了该库文件的版本号、适用的Python版本、支持的操作系统类型以及对应的硬件平台。这里的"egg"是一种Python的分发格式,类似于Java中的.jar文件,包含了一组可以被Python解释器执行的代码。
7. 资源来源与官方认证:
官方资源通常意味着该库文件是经过原开发者或项目团队发布的,可靠性相对较高。在描述中提到资源来源于官方,这表明该库文件是由Ev3dev项目或其授权开发者提供的。
8. 安装方法:
描述中提供了安装该库的方法链接,指向了CSDN博客的一篇文章。通常安装方法会包括如何获取、解压、配置和使用库文件的详细步骤。在实际操作过程中,开发者需要遵循这些步骤以确保库文件能被正确安装和使用。
9. 标签说明:
标签"python linux 3d 开发语言 运维"提供了资源文件的关键词,反映了该库文件可能涉及到的领域和技能点。其中Python是编程语言,Linux是一个操作系统,3D可能表示该库与三维图形处理相关,开发语言说明这是一个编程相关的资源,运维则可能指在系统运维过程中可能会用到这个库。
10. 压缩包子文件的文件名称列表:
在本例中,压缩包子文件的文件名称列表只有一个项目,即"python_ev3dev-0.2.1.post11-py2.7-linux-armv5tejl.egg"。这个列表显示了压缩包文件的完整名称,通常用于下载或者在代码中引用该资源。
总结以上知识点,我们可以得知,"python_ev3dev-0.2.1.post11-py2.7-linux-armv5tejl.egg"是一个专为Python 2.7版本编写的,用于Linux操作系统上的EV3DEV开发的第三方库文件。开发者在使用前需要解压该文件,并参照官方提供的安装指南进行安装。标签中的信息显示,该库可能与三维图形或系统运维有关,但具体功能需要进一步查阅官方文档或相关开发资料来确定。
2022-02-26 上传
2022-03-06 上传
2022-05-16 上传
2022-04-01 上传
2022-05-17 上传
2022-04-10 上传
2022-03-11 上传
2022-05-24 上传
2022-05-16 上传
挣扎的蓝藻
- 粉丝: 14w+
- 资源: 15万+
最新资源
- 平尾装配工作平台运输支撑系统设计与应用
- MAX-MIN Ant System:用MATLAB解决旅行商问题
- Flutter状态管理新秀:sealed_flutter_bloc包整合seal_unions
- Pong²开源游戏:双人对战图形化的经典竞技体验
- jQuery spriteAnimator插件:创建精灵动画的利器
- 广播媒体对象传输方法与设备的技术分析
- MATLAB HDF5数据提取工具:深层结构化数据处理
- 适用于arm64的Valgrind交叉编译包发布
- 基于canvas和Java后端的小程序“飞翔的小鸟”完整示例
- 全面升级STM32F7 Discovery LCD BSP驱动程序
- React Router v4 入门教程与示例代码解析
- 下载OpenCV各版本安装包,全面覆盖2.4至4.5
- 手写笔画分割技术的新突破:智能分割方法与装置
- 基于Koplowitz & Bruckstein算法的MATLAB周长估计方法
- Modbus4j-3.0.3版本免费下载指南
- PoqetPresenter:Sharp Zaurus上的开源OpenOffice演示查看器